Baked Havarti Eggs

4 teaspoon butter
4 tablespoons half and half
4 large eggs
Salt and freshly ground pepper to taste
4 heaping tablespoons grated Havarti cheese (do not substitute)
1/2 teaspoon dill
  1. Preheat oven to 450*F (230*C).
  2. Place 1 teaspoon butter into 4 ovenproof ramekin dishes, place in oven to melt.
  3. Remove from oven and add 1 tablespoon half-and-half and crack 1 egg into each dish. Season with salt and pepper to taste
  4. Cover each egg with 1 tablespoon Havarti. Sprinkle dill evenly over each.
  5. Bake for 8 to 10 minutes or until egg white is done with yolk softly cooked.

Makes 4 servings.
